The eyeball
is one of the special sense organs and is responsible for vision.

Light rays travel through the:

Cornea


Pupil


Iris


Lens


+Land on the Retina


To produce images.

Myopic

Related to nearsightedness.



Accessory organs of the eye are: Conjunctiva


Eyelids


Lacrimal glands

Ophthalmology:

the diagnosis and treatment of diseases and conditions of the eye and vision

Ophthalmologists:

are medical doctors (MD) receive 4 years of specialized training after medical school

What do Ophthalmologists do?
Perform vision exams

Prescribe corrective lenses


Diagnose and treat eye conditions


Perform eye surgery

Optometrist

obtains a doctor of optometry (OD) degree after completing 4 years at a school of optometry.

Optometry specializes in:
Assessing vision

Prescribing corrective lenses


Treating glaucoma, corneal damage, visual skill problems


Pre- and post-surgical care


Screening for other eye diseases.

Optician

is not a doctor.


grinds/make glasses.

acque/o
water
blephar/o
eyelid
choroid/o
choroid layer
conjunctiv/o
conjunctiva
core/o
pupil

corne/o

cornea

cycl/o
ciliary body
dacry/o
tears
ir/o
iris
irid/o
iris
kerat/o
cornea
lacrim/o
tears
ocul/o
eye
ophthalm/o
eye
opt/o
eye, vision
phac/o
lens
pupill/o
pupil
retin/o
retina
scler/o
sclera
ton/o
tension, pressure
vitre/o
glassy
aden/o
gland
ambly/o
dull, dim
angio/o
vessel
chrom/o
color
cry/o
cold
cyst/o
sac, urinary bladder
dipl/o
double
myc/o
fungus
nas/o
nose
phot/o
light
xer/o
dry
-logist
one who studies
-logy
study of
-malacia
abnormal softening
-megaly
enlarged
-meter
instrument for measuring
-metry
process of measuring
-opia
vision
-osis
abnormal condition
-otomy
cutting into
-ous
pertaining to
-pathy

disease

-pexy

surgical fixation
-phobia
fear
-plasty
surgical repair
-plegia
paralysis
-ptosis
drooping
-rrhea
discharge, flow
-sclerosis
hardening
-scope
instrument for viewing
-scopy

process of visually examining

a-
without
an-
without
hemi-
half
hyper-
excessive
intra-
within
micro-
small
